Police have withdrawn rape allegations against a man who was accused of sexually assaulting a woman at a CBD address.
In the Adelaide Magistrates Court on Wednesday, prosecutors dropped a rape charge against Allan Stanley Booth, 35.
Previously, they had alleged Mr Booth had met a woman in the city in March and gone with her to a King William St hotel.
They further alleged that, the following morning, Mr Booth sexually assaulted the woman, and that she pushed him away and left.
Police did not give any reason, on Wednesday, for their decision to drop the charge.
